Banco (BSAC) market analysis | revenue trends and price momentum remain in focus. Banco Santander Chile (BSAC) is currently trading at $32.01, reflecting a modest decline of 0.39% on the day. The stock remains within its established range, with key support at $30.41 and resistance at $33.61. This slight pullback follows a period of relative strength and may signal a consolidation phase as traders assess the bank’s sector positioning.
